  5. my brief summation.  
    1. Who is it that was lackadaisical?  Was it Young  Ickey was referring to

    2.  Canales continues to say the ‘me to connection ; ie qb to receivers is failing 

    3.  Young a great guy but not right as starter for the panthers   However, after 2.5 years,  too much bad play and too much inconsistency with a stable coaching staff and weapons References Mark Schlerth’s  comments… Young  couldn’t complete passes downfield    

    4. Mentions failures with Young due to Tepper in 2023  possibly did damage to Young    Maybe young needs a fresh start   So do the Panthers    wants to see Canales getting a 3rd year with his chosen QB   Cox counters, Maye had a bad situation in his rookie year but excelled this year 

    5. Discussed Young’s data on metric of ‘catchable pass rate’  the metric shows

             A.   Young fails on catchable passes other than 0 to 9 yards 

              B.  McMillan is most effective 10 to 19  as one example, of WRs not being allowed to be at their best yardage 

               C     all 22 shows Legette is open a lot and ignored 

    6. Lea discusses the impact of losing Thielen on Young I.e. given young’s comfort with short passes, young misses Thielen   Young is starting to replace Adam with Jatevon  Sanders and he makes the decision before the snap to go to him regardless

  13. Next Gen Stats Insight for Saints-Panthers (via NFL Pro): 

     

    Much of Tyler Shough’s production was directed outside the numbers, as he finished 11 of 16 for 202 yards and both of his touchdowns on such attempts.

    His yardage total outside the numbers was the second-most by a Saints quarterback in the last eight seasons and most by any rookie in 2025.

    NFL Research:

    The Panthers had their sixth game of the season with seven or fewer points in the first half.

    Carolina is 2-15 when Bryce Young starts at QB and has less than 70 yards in the first half in his career.
